Output 75299e0848324c048fd95169b7a3cd65629166fc410319629e4d98b3edc57004:1

value
26457
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6e13868463770e781ef42e8e7a850bd853f3de7 OP_EQUALVERIFY OP_CHECKSIG
address
1HfynVp9aaPthbB7omz1zDMieLrmawkfSh
transaction
75299e0848324c048fd95169b7a3cd65629166fc410319629e4d98b3edc57004
confirmations
343785
spent
true